Darraweit Valley Cider was born out of a thirst for something different.
Our Orchardist, Marc Serafino is a former head chef with a passion for creating new flavours. By experimenting with flavours that work, he loves creating something new that can elevate the traditional cider experience. In 2010, Marc started to get serious about cider. His intricate perception of flavours led to his distinct cider style.
Marc soon discovered that to make some of the best craft ciders you need to start with the right cider apples. So he set off to establish his own orchard. In 2014, the first apple trees were planted and Darraweit Valley Cider House was established in the stunning valleys of the Macedon Ranges. In our short and proud history, we’ve already started to shake things up. Our unique ciders have been recognised with a bunch of accolades and positive reviews.
